Java:绽放编程世界的璀璨星光

简介: Java:绽放编程世界的璀璨星光

1.摘要:

作为一门强大而受欢迎的编程语言,Java已经深深地嵌入到现代技术世界中。本文将带您走进Java的奇妙世界,探索其优势和应用领域,并为您展示在CSDN(中国软件开发者社区)这个知识交流平台上学习和探索Java的无穷魅力。

引言:Java,作为一门全面、高效、多用途的编程语言,已经跨越了行业和学术界的壁垒,成为世界上最受欢迎的编程语言之一。它的强大功能和广泛的应用领域使得学习和掌握Java成为当今开发者们的必备技能之一。而在知识分享和交流的大舞台上,CSDN已经成为广大程序员们互相学习和交流的热门社区。本文将以Java为主线,以CSDN为背景,带您领略Java的无限潜力和与众不同之处。

第一部分:引领编程潮流的Java

Java的历史回顾: 首先,我们将回顾Java的起源和发展。Java的诞生可以追溯到20世纪90年代初,由Sun Microsystems公司(后来被Oracle收购)开发。从最初的Oak到如今是一门面向对象的编程语言,具备平台无关性,可移植性强,兼容性广泛。其强大的生态系统支持丰富的第三方库和开发工具,拓宽了Java开发的可能性。同时,Java具备良好的并发性能和垃圾回收机制,使得开发者可以专注于业务逻辑,而不必过多担心底层实现细节。

第二部分:Java在实际应用中的广泛应用

Java在企业级应用中的应用

: Java在企业级应用领域具有广泛的应用,如电子商务、金融、医疗、物流等。我们将深入了解Java在这些领域的实际应用案例,并介绍一些流行的Java框架和技术,如Spring和Hibernate,它们为企业应用开发提供了强大的支持。

Java在移动应用领域的应用

: 随着智能手机的普及,移动应用开发成为热门的领域。Java通过其跨平台特性,成为了Android应用开发的首选语言。我们将介绍一些知名的Java开发工具和框架,如Android Studio和React Native,帮助您进入移动应用开发的世界。

Java在大数据和人工智能领域的应用

: 在大数据和人工智能领域,Java也发挥着重要的作用。我们将介绍一些Java生态系统中的大数据和人工智能相关框架和库,如Hadoop和TensorFlow,帮助您了解Java在这些领域的应用。

第三部分:Java学习和交流的乐园——CSDN

CSDN的介绍:

接下来,我们将为您介绍CSDN这个热门的知识交流平台。CSDN致力于为广大开发者闪耀光芒,探索无限可能!作为中国软件开发者社区,CSDN汇聚了全球范围内的技术专家和开发者,提供各种丰富的Java学习资源和社区互动平台。

Java技术论坛

: CSDN的Java技术论坛是广大Java开发者交流的热门场所。在这里,您可以与其他具有专业知识和经验的开发者进行互动和学习。您可以提问与Java相关的问题,并得到及时的解答和指导。同时,您也可以分享自己的经验和技术成果,与各行各业的开发者一起共同成长。

Java博客文章

: CSDN上有大量关于Java的优质博客文章。这些文章由行业内的专家和热心开发者撰写,并涵盖了Java的各个领域和应用。您可以在这些博客文章中深入了解Java的最新发展和技术趋势,获得实用的编程技巧和解决方案。无论您是新手还是有经验的开发者,这些博客文章都能帮助您提升技能,拓宽思路。

Java资源下载

: CSDN提供丰富的Java学习资源下载,包括Java开发工具、框架、示例代码等。您可以从CSDN获取最新版本的Java开发工具,如Eclipse和IntelliJ IDEA,以及各种热门的Java框架和库,如Spring和MyBatis。这些资源可以帮助您更高效地进行Java开发,加快项目的开发进度。

结语:

Java作为一门强大而受欢迎的编程语言,为开发者们打开了无限的创作空间。在CSDN这个热门的知识交流平台上,您可以通过参与Java技术论坛、阅读优质的博客文章以及下载丰富的学习资源,加深对Java的理解和应用。无论您是初学者还是有经验的开发者,CSDN都是您学习和交流Java的理想乐园。

希望本文能够让您对Java和CSDN有更深入的了解,并激发您对学习和探索Java的热情。愿Java这颗璀璨的星光继续闪耀,为编程世界带来无限的可能性

目录
相关文章
|
1天前
|
缓存 Java 数据库
Java并发编程学习11-任务执行演示
【5月更文挑战第4天】本篇将结合任务执行和 Executor 框架的基础知识,演示一些不同版本的任务执行Demo,并且每个版本都实现了不同程度的并发性。
20 4
Java并发编程学习11-任务执行演示
|
2天前
|
存储 安全 Java
12条通用编程原则✨全面提升Java编码规范性、可读性及性能表现
12条通用编程原则✨全面提升Java编码规范性、可读性及性能表现
|
2天前
|
缓存 Java 程序员
关于创建、销毁对象⭐Java程序员需要掌握的8个编程好习惯
关于创建、销毁对象⭐Java程序员需要掌握的8个编程好习惯
关于创建、销毁对象⭐Java程序员需要掌握的8个编程好习惯
|
2天前
|
缓存 Java 数据库
Java并发编程中的锁优化策略
【5月更文挑战第9天】 在高负载的多线程应用中,Java并发编程的高效性至关重要。本文将探讨几种常见的锁优化技术,旨在提高Java应用程序在并发环境下的性能。我们将从基本的synchronized关键字开始,逐步深入到更高效的Lock接口实现,以及Java 6引入的java.util.concurrent包中的高级工具类。文中还会介绍读写锁(ReadWriteLock)的概念和实现原理,并通过对比分析各自的优势和适用场景,为开发者提供实用的锁优化策略。
4 0
|
3天前
|
JavaScript 小程序 Java
基于java的少儿编程网上报名系统
基于java的少儿编程网上报名系统
11 2
|
3天前
|
存储 安全 算法
掌握Java并发编程:Lock、Condition与并发集合
掌握Java并发编程:Lock、Condition与并发集合
11 0
|
3天前
|
Java 测试技术 图形学
掌握Java GUI编程基础知识
掌握Java GUI编程基础知识
7 0
|
3天前
|
SQL Java 数据库连接
Java数据库编程实践:连接与操作数据库
Java数据库编程实践:连接与操作数据库
9 0
|
3天前
|
安全 Java 程序员
深入探索Java泛型编程
深入探索Java泛型编程
7 0
|
3天前
|
Java 编译器 开发者
Java并发编程中的锁优化策略
【5月更文挑战第8天】在Java并发编程中,锁是实现线程同步的关键机制。为了提高程序的性能,我们需要对锁进行优化。本文将介绍Java并发编程中的锁优化策略,包括锁粗化、锁消除、锁降级和读写锁等方法,以帮助开发者提高多线程应用的性能。